South Korea’s Cultural Renaissance
South Korea is a standout among the best countries to visit in 2026, especially with the 2026 World Expo in Busan. Beyond K-pop and K-dramas, the country offers serene temples, vibrant street food scenes, and stunning coastal drives. The DMZ tour remains a poignant experience, while the islands of Jeju showcase volcanic landscapes and waterfalls. With improved infrastructure and affordable travel options, South Korea is more accessible than ever.

Eco-Tourism in the Andes
Peru and Ecuador are leading the charge in sustainable tourism, a key factor in why they’re among the best countries to visit in 2026. The Inca Trail’s renovation and new conservation efforts protect sacred sites. Meanwhile, the Galápagos Islands continue to offer unparalleled wildlife encounters. Travelers can support local communities through homestays and organic farms, ensuring their visit benefits the region long-term.

Timing Your Trip Perfectly
Selecting the right time to visit is crucial for the best countries to visit in 2026. Avoid peak seasons if you dislike crowds, but note that some festivals only occur during specific months. For example, Japan’s cherry blossoms in spring and Australia’s Sydney Festival in January draw massive crowds. Research weather patterns and local holidays to maximize your experience.
FAQs About Traveling in 2026
- What are the visa requirements for popular destinations in 2026? Many countries now offer e-visas or visa-on-arrival options. Check official government websites for updates, as policies can change rapidly.
- Is 2026 safe for solo female travelers? Yes, but choose destinations with strong female-friendly infrastructure. Countries like New Zealand and Portugal consistently rank high for safety and inclusivity.
- What’s the average cost of travel in 2026? Budget travelers can explore Southeast Asia or Eastern Europe for under $50/day. Western Europe and North America require higher budgets, but deals exist with early booking.
- How can I reduce my carbon footprint while traveling? Opt for trains over flights when possible, stay in eco-certified accommodations, and support local businesses. Apps like Eco-Passport help track your impact.
- Are family-friendly destinations different in 2026? Yes, with more all-inclusive resorts and activity-based vacations. Countries like Costa Rica and Japan offer easy family logistics and kid-friendly excursions.
- Where can I find reliable travel information? Trusted sources include government tourism boards, UNESCO, and World Travel Guide. Social media can be misleading, so stick to official sites.
